    I was born outside of Pittsburgh, near the Pittsburgh International Airport, and grew up in Hopewell Township, Pennsylvania. I have one brother, who is three years older than me.

    My parents were first-generation-born Americans. My grandparents and great-grandparents emigrated from Europe for a better life in America.     No. I’m just on the heels of Title IX. When I was in high school, they had just introduced girls’ sports. The first sport was track and field, and if there were ever a sport I wasn’t going to be good at, it was track and field.     Oh yeah! I was in numerous clubs in high school. I was in the Conservation Club, Choir, Marching Band, and Jazz bands, and in some school plays.

    My mother and father felt it was important for us to play the piano, and we were both in the band. I listened to music on my 8-track tapes. Before I went to college, my first stadium concert was Beach Boys, Peter Frampton, and Gary Wright at the former Three Rivers Stadium.     Work ethic was very big in our family. I think that’s probably big in every immigrant family. My great-grandparents, grandparents and my parents worked very hard.     Some of it is innate, and some of it is because my family always instilled in us that we should do our best and use every talent we have. My grandmother lived just a few miles away, and she was always instilling important family values in us, so I tried to replicate that.

Nov 26, 2019 · UNIVERSITY PARK, Pa. -- Marilyn Wells, the provost and senior vice president for academic affairs at Minnesota State University, Mankato, has been appointed as the new chancellor of Penn State Brandywine.   7. Feb 26, 2020 · The Brandywine campus of Pennsylvania State University recently appointed Marilyn Wells as chancellor following the retirement of former Chancellor Kristin Woolever last July. Wells was chosen to be the new chancellor after a lengthy interviewing process, which included student-led forums with potential candidates.
